[2], In its final stages, the Indian's displacement was 950cc (as built it was 600cc) and was driven by a triple chain drive system. In 1966, he set a 1,000 cc class record of 168.07 mph, with a 920 cc engine, and finally, in 1967, he set an under-1,000 cc class record of 183.59 mph, with a 950 cc engine.
